Tyus Jones: From Duke to the NBA

Tyus Jones first grabbed national attention as a standout player for Duke University. During his time with the Blue Devils, Tyus showcased exceptional court vision, playmaking abilities, and a knack for hitting clutch shots. One of the highlights of his college career was undoubtedly the 2015 NCAA Tournament, where he led Duke to a national championship victory. Tyus's performance in the tournament, especially his composure in high-pressure situations, solidified his reputation as a promising young point guard. His ability to control the tempo of the game and make smart decisions with the ball quickly made him a fan favorite and a player to watch. This success at Duke paved the way for his transition to the NBA.

After declaring for the NBA draft, Tyus was selected by the Minnesota Timberwolves in the first round. His arrival in the NBA marked the beginning of a new chapter, where he would need to adapt his skills to the professional level. In his early years with the Timberwolves, Tyus primarily served as a backup point guard, learning from veteran players and gradually honing his skills. He demonstrated a high basketball IQ and a solid understanding of offensive systems, which allowed him to contribute effectively whenever his number was called. While playing behind established guards, Tyus focused on improving his consistency and decision-making, laying the groundwork for a longer and more impactful NBA career. His time in Minnesota was crucial for his development, giving him the experience needed to thrive in the league.

Tre Jones: Rising Through the Ranks

On the other hand, Tre Jones also made a name for himself in college basketball, following in his brother's footsteps by playing for Duke University. Although he had big shoes to fill, Tre quickly established his own identity as a reliable and skilled point guard. Known for his defensive prowess and playmaking abilities, Tre brought a different dimension to the Blue Devils' lineup. His tenacious defense and ability to disrupt opposing offenses made him a valuable asset on the court. Tre's college career was characterized by his consistent performance and leadership qualities, earning him recognition as one of the top point guards in the nation. He consistently demonstrated his ability to control the game and make smart plays, making him a key player for Duke.

Following his successful college career, Tre entered the NBA draft and was selected by the San Antonio Spurs. Joining the Spurs organization, known for its player development program, was a significant step in his professional journey. In San Antonio, Tre has been working diligently to refine his skills and adapt to the NBA game. He has shown flashes of potential, particularly on the defensive end, where his quick hands and instincts allow him to create turnovers and disrupt opponents. As he gains more experience and playing time, Tre is expected to continue to develop his offensive game and become an even more impactful player for the Spurs. The Spurs' focus on fundamental basketball and strategic play should provide an excellent environment for Tre to grow and reach his full potential.

Tyus Jones: The Steady Hand

Tyus Jones is renowned for his exceptional court vision and decision-making. He's the kind of point guard who always seems to make the right play, whether it’s finding an open teammate, driving to the basket, or pulling up for a mid-range jumper. His assist-to-turnover ratio is consistently among the best in the league, showcasing his ability to take care of the ball and minimize mistakes. This is a critical trait for a point guard, as it ensures the team maintains possession and maximizes scoring opportunities. Tyus's poise under pressure is another key aspect of his game. He doesn't get rattled easily, even in high-stakes situations, which makes him a reliable player to have on the court in crunch time. His ability to remain calm and focused helps him make smart decisions when the game is on the line.

In terms of offense, Tyus excels in running the pick-and-roll and creating opportunities for his teammates. He has a knack for finding the open man and delivering accurate passes, whether it’s a quick dish to a cutting player or a long pass to a shooter on the perimeter. His basketball IQ is exceptionally high, allowing him to anticipate plays and make the right reads. While not known as a prolific scorer, Tyus has a reliable jump shot and can knock down shots from beyond the arc when left open. His scoring ability keeps defenders honest and prevents them from focusing solely on his passing. Overall, Tyus’s offensive game is characterized by efficiency and smart play, making him a valuable asset for any team.

Defensively, Tyus is a smart and disciplined player who understands angles and positioning. He's not the most physically imposing defender, but he uses his quickness and anticipation to disrupt opposing offenses. He's adept at getting steals and deflections, which can lead to fast-break opportunities for his team. His defensive awareness and ability to read the game make him a solid defender, even against more athletic opponents. Tyus’s commitment to playing smart, team-oriented defense is a testament to his overall basketball IQ and dedication to winning.
